Benefits of UPVC Doors
Before diving into the replacement procedure, it's important to comprehend the benefits of UPVC doors. Here are some notable advantages:
- Durability: UPVC doors are resistant to rot, rust, and deterioration, making them an excellent choice for various climates.
- Low Maintenance: Unlike wooden doors, UPVC requires very little upkeep. A simple wipe-down with soap and water is adequate to keep them looking great.
- Energy Efficiency: These doors offer exceptional insulation, helping to keep your home warm in winter and cool in summertime. This can lead to considerable savings on energy bills.
- Variety of Styles: UPVC doors can be found in a variety of designs, colors, and surfaces, permitting homeowners to customize their appearance.
- Economical: Compared to other materials like lumber and aluminum, UPVC doors offer a cost-effective solution for door replacements.

The UPVC Door Replacement Process
Changing a UPVC door may seem complicated, however understanding the procedure can make it more manageable. Here's a step-by-step guide:
- Measuring: Measure the door frame measurements properly, including width, height, and depth.
- Choosing the Door: Select your new UPVC door based on the aspects talked about earlier.
- Eliminating the Old Door: Carefully remove the existing door and frame, guaranteeing not to harm the surrounding wall or floor.
- Preparing the Frame: Clean the opening and make any essential changes to guarantee a tight fit for the brand-new door.
- Setting Up the New Door: Place the new door into the frame, securing it with screws and guaranteeing it is level and plumb.
- Sealing: Apply appropriate sealant around the frame to prevent drafts and water ingress.
- Fitting Hardware: Attach locks, deals with, and any other hardware before evaluating the door's operation.
- Completing Touches: Install any trim or finishing touches to improve the general appearance.
FAQs about UPVC Door Replacement
Q1: How long does a UPVC door last?A1: Generally, UPVC doors can last between 20 to 30 years, depending on elements such as environment and maintenance. Q2: Can I replace a UPVC door myself?A2: While DIY replacements are possible, employing an expert ensures correct setup and can avoid problems down the line. Q3: How do I preserve my UPVC door?A3: Regular cleansing with moderate soap and water is advised.
